Jacksonville, Fl — These are the final days of Colors of the Wild at the Jacksonville Zoo and Gardens. From the towering cherry blossoms of Asia to the native panthers and manatees of Florida, each lantern tells a unique story highlighting diverse cultures around the world.

Hundreds of recreational vehicles from pop-up campers to Class A motorhomes will be on display during the 2025 Jacksonville RV MegaShow from Thursday, Feb. 6 – Sunday, Feb. 9 at the Jacksonville Equestrian Center.
